The 237-room Renaissance Curacao Resort & Casino is on schedule to open in the third quarter of 2008 as the first new branded resort on the island in 15 years, according to Maylin Trenidad, general manager.

“We’re planning a grand opening celebration to welcome guests at a resort where old-world Curacao meets new-world luxury,” Trenidad said.

The hotel is located on the waterfront of Willemstad, the capital, and is home to the legendary Rif Fort, a 19th century landmark and a World Heritage site. All guest rooms will be equipped with high speed Internet, a mini-refrigerator, a coffeemaker and a flat screen TV.

Facilities will include an infinity pool; access to a private beach; 15 restaurants, lounges and bars; the Rif Fort’s open-air Boulevard and Renaissance Mall with up to 50 shops, cafes and bars; the 15,000-square-foot Carnaval Casino with slots, table games and a six-cinema movie theater; and a spa and fitness center.
